Campfire Cooking Station: Practical DIY Camping Kitchen Ideas
Let simple materials and clever design turn any campsite into a functional outdoor kitchen where cooking feels like an adventure rather than a chore, like setting up a rustic camp kitchen under the stars with everything you need within reach.
- Pallet Counters – You’ll love how wooden pallets become sturdy counters or work tables that provide plenty of prep space and a rustic, camp-ready look.
- Hanging Utensil Racks – Hang spoons, spatulas, and pots from ropes or hooks to keep tools organized and off the ground, saving valuable table space.
- Portable Sink Stations – Build a simple sink using a basin, PVC pipes, and a water jug for easy dishwashing and hand cleaning at camp.
- Multi-Level Shelving – Stack crates or build tiered shelves to create vertical storage for plates, spices, and cooking essentials.
- Rolling Camp Kitchens – Add wheels to a pallet base so your entire kitchen can roll easily from the car to the campsite.
- Fire-Side Prep Areas – Design a low counter or side table near the fire pit for safe, convenient food prep while cooking over flames.
- Utensil & Tool Organizers – Use mason jars, magnetic strips, or hooks to keep knives, tongs, and gadgets neatly stored and accessible.
- Weatherproof Covers – Add simple tarps or hinged lids to protect your setup from rain and dew overnight.
- Cozy Lighting – Hang solar lanterns or string lights around your DIY camping kitchen to create a warm, inviting glow after dark.
From Campsite to Kitchen: Step-by-Step Guide to DIY Camping Kitchen Ideas
Start with a clear plan and simple supplies — these DIY camping kitchen ideas are designed to be portable, durable, and easy to set up so you can focus on enjoying the outdoors.
- Assess Your Needs – Think about how many people you’ll cook for, what meals you’ll make, and how much counter and storage space you’ll need.
- Gather Materials – Collect wooden pallets, crates, PVC pipes, screws, wheels (optional), tarps, and basic tools that are easy to transport.
- Build the Base – Construct a sturdy counter or table using pallets or lumber, making sure it’s level and strong enough for cooking.
- Add Storage & Shelving – Install open shelves, hooks, or crates underneath or on the sides for pots, pans, and ingredients.
- Create a Sink Area – Set up a simple portable sink with a basin, jug, and drainage pipe for easy cleanup.
- Add Hanging Solutions – Use ropes, hooks, or racks to hang utensils, towels, and lights to keep the workspace organized.
- Make It Mobile (Optional) – Add locking wheels if you want to move the entire kitchen easily between the car and campsite.
- Protect from Weather – Add a tarp or hinged cover to shield your setup from rain and morning dew.
- Set Up & Enjoy – Arrange your tools, light the lanterns, and enjoy cooking under the stars in your new DIY camping kitchen.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What materials are best for a DIY kitchen island?
Ans: Reclaimed wood, old pallets, pine lumber, crates, and butcher block tops work wonderfully for a DIY kitchen island, offering authentic texture, strength, and that desired farmhouse character.
Q: How tall should a DIY kitchen island be?
Ans: Standard kitchen island height is 36 inches (counter height) to match most kitchen counters, though you can build it taller (42 inches) if you prefer bar-style seating with stools.
Q: Can I add wheels to my DIY kitchen island?
Ans: Yes, adding locking casters is a popular feature in DIY kitchen island ideas, allowing you to move the island easily for extra prep space or entertaining.
Q: Do I need advanced woodworking skills to build a DIY kitchen island?
Ans: No, many DIY kitchen island ideas are beginner-friendly using basic tools, screws, and simple joinery — reclaimed wood and crates make the process even more approachable.
Q: How can I make my DIY kitchen island look more rustic?
Ans: Distress the wood, leave knots and imperfections visible, use matte or oil finishes, and add simple hardware or towel bars to enhance the warm, handmade rustic feel.
